The hazardous waste transporter regulations were developed by which two agencies?

Explanation:
Transportation of hazardous waste is governed by two federal rule sets. The Environmental Protection Agency establishes the rules for how hazardous waste is generated, stored, and disposed under RCRA, including the requirement to use a hazardous waste manifest to track shipments from generator to disposal facility. The Department of Transportation regulates the actual transport of hazardous materials through the Hazardous Materials Regulations, covering packaging, labeling, placarding, shipping papers, and carrier responsibilities. Together, these agencies ensure hazardous waste is properly managed at the point of generation and safely transported to its destination. Other agencies like OSHA or FDA don’t administer the primary transporter rules; OSHA focuses on workplace safety, and FDA on foods and drugs.
